Table of Contents

Class SelectColumn<T>

Namespace
MudBlazor
Assembly
MudBlazor.dll

Represents a checkbox column used to select rows in a MudDataGrid<T>.

public class SelectColumn<T> : ComponentBase, IComponent, IHandleEvent, IHandleAfterRender

Type Parameters

T

The type of item to select.

Inheritance
SelectColumn<T>
Implements
Inherited Members
Extension Methods

Constructors

SelectColumn()

public SelectColumn()

Properties

DragAndDropEnabled

Allows this column to be reordered via drag-and-drop operations.

[Parameter]
public bool? DragAndDropEnabled { get; set; }

Property Value

bool?

Remarks

Defaults to null. When set, this overrides the DragDropColumnReordering property.

Hidden

Hides this column.

[Parameter]
public bool Hidden { get; set; }

Property Value

bool

Remarks

Defaults to false.

HiddenChanged

Occurs when the Hidden property has changed.

[Parameter]
public EventCallback<bool> HiddenChanged { get; set; }

Property Value

EventCallback<bool>

Hideable

Allows this column to be hidden.

[Parameter]
public bool? Hideable { get; set; }

Property Value

bool?

Remarks

Defaults to null. When set, this overrides the Hideable property.

ShowInFooter

Shows a checkbox in the footer.

[Parameter]
public bool ShowInFooter { get; set; }

Property Value

bool

Remarks

When true, all rows can be checked by selecting this checkbox.

ShowInHeader

Shows a checkbox in the header.

[Parameter]
public bool ShowInHeader { get; set; }

Property Value

bool

Remarks

When true, all rows can be checked by selecting this checkbox.

Size

The size of the checkbox icon.

[Parameter]
public Size Size { get; set; }

Property Value

Size

Remarks

Defaults to Medium.

Methods

BuildRenderTree(RenderTreeBuilder)

protected override void BuildRenderTree(RenderTreeBuilder __builder)

Parameters

__builder RenderTreeBuilder

See Also